Where Dogs Heal, Connect, and Create Change
K9 Healers is the therapy and social impact division of K9 School, connecting trained dogs and people through therapy, rehabilitation, and community welfare programs.
Founded in 2016 by Adnaan Khan, K9 Healers uses science-backed, welfare-first canine intervention to support emotional well-being, confidence, and stronger human-dog connections. From hospitals and schools to rehabilitation centres, our programs help create positive change through compassion, training, and responsible care.

Rescue Dog Transformation
Giving rescued dogs a second chance through care, rehabilitation, and purpose.
K9 Healers works with rescued and injured dogs by providing supervised rehabilitation, medical care, and a clear path toward rehabilitation and a better future. Some dogs go on to become therapy dogs, while others are prepared for safe and loving forever homes.
What the program covers:
- Medical care and recovery support at the Delhi Rehabilitation Centre
- Behavioural assessment and structured training
- Confidence rebuilding through compassionate, positive methods
- Preparation for therapy roles or responsible rehoming
The goal is not just rescue. It is rehabilitation, helping every dog find a role and a future.
Alwar Community Neutering Program
Creating safer communities through compassion, care, and responsible animal welfare.
K9 Healers partnered with Alwar Public School to humanely sterilise street dogs in Alwar, combining veterinary care, community education, and awareness to improve animal welfare and reduce the number of homeless animals in the region.
Program outcomes:
- 350+ dogs sterilised with zero mortality
- Active collaboration with Alwar Public School
- Community education on responsible animal care
- Young minds are introduced to empathy and animal welfare through direct involvement
Therapy Dog Training and Certification
Preparing dogs to bring comfort, support, and positive change responsibly.
What therapy dog certification includes:
Temperament and stability assessment
Obedience and calm behaviour training
Public behaviour and socialisation skills
Handler education and ethical practices
Not every dog is suited for therapy work. K9 Healers follows a rigorous certification process that evaluates temperament, builds essential behaviour skills, and prepares dogs and handlers for safe, ethical therapy and service dog environments.
Inside Tihar Jail, K9 Healers engaged 150 juvenile inmates through structured dog interaction sessions designed to build emotional discipline, empathy, responsibility, and self-regulation.
Dogs do not judge. They respond to how they are treated, which makes structured dog interaction one of the most direct and effective tools for developing emotional accountability in high-pressure environments. The Tihar program was built on this principle, with every session led by trained handlers following structured behaviour science protocols.
